What Types of Work and Facilities Can School Psychologists Expect in Tempe, AZ?

As a School Psychologist in Tempe, Arizona, you will have the opportunity to work in a dynamic educational environment where you can make a profound impact on students’ lives. You may find yourself collaborating with teachers and parents at public and private schools, focusing on student assessment, intervention strategies, and promoting mental health awareness within the classroom. Additionally, you could be involved in developing individualized education plans (IEPs) for students with special needs, conducting workshops, and providing counseling services to address academic challenges and emotional well-being. Tempe, home to a vibrant community and close to educational institutions like Arizona State University, offers a range of facilities including K-12 schools, alternative education programs, and mental health clinics, all of which seek dedicated professionals committed to fostering a positive learning atmosphere and supporting students’ diverse psychological needs.

AMN Healthcare is partnering with a top school district in Tempe, Arizona to hire a School Psychologist to work in the area, providing services to children of all ages. This School Psychologist will provide counseling services to students on Individualized Education Plans (IEPs) and to the regular student population (treating mood disorders, autism, anxiety, depression, ADHD, social skill deficits, conduct disorders) to foster positive coping strategies, motivation, and skill development. Responsibilities will include conducting psychological assessments and evaluations to identify students’ needs and strengths, developing and implementing individualized education plans (IEPs) and 504 Plans, provide individual and group counseling to students to address emotional and behavioral issue. They will collaborate with teachers, parents, and administrators to create supportive learning environments, provide crisis intervention and support for students and staff as needed. They will also coordinate outreach activities that support students and families including pediatricians, outside counseling agencies, and agencies such as DCF, DMH, etc.

Similar Cities to Tempe, Arizona, for School Psychologists: Opportunities, Lifestyle, and Pay Comparisons

One city that shares similarities with Tempe, Arizona, for working as a school psychologist is Flagstaff, Arizona. Flagstaff is a vibrant college town with a strong educational atmosphere, thanks to the presence of Northern Arizona University. The cost of living is somewhat higher than in Tempe, but still affordable compared to larger metropolitan areas in the state, and the average salary for school psychologists is comparable. The climate is cooler, with distinct seasons including snowy winters and mild summers, providing a different experience than the heat of Tempe.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ate Flagstaff’s proximity to the San Francisco Peaks and numerous hiking and biking trails, fostering a relaxed and active lifestyle.

Next, consider Denver, Colorado, which also offers many of the same professional opportunities for school psychologists. The pay range in Denver is attractive, and while the cost of living is higher than in Tempe, it is still manageable given the competitive salaries in the education sector. The climate offers a mix of sunny days and snow, similar to Tempe’s pleasant winter temperatures, and it allows residents to enjoy a variety of outdoor activities, including skiing, hiking, and biking. The city is known for its vibrant arts scene, breweries, and an abundance of events, making it a lively place to work and play.

Another comparable city is Tucson, Arizona, which is just a couple of hours’ drive from Tempe. Tucson has a lower cost of living relative to Tempe and offers competitive salaries for school psychologists. The climate is similar, with hot summers and mild winters, although Tucson tends to be slightly warmer. This city boasts beautiful desert landscapes and a rich cultural heritage, providing a plethora of outdoor activities like hiking in the Saguaro National Park. Additionally, Tucson has a more laid-back lifestyle with a strong focus on family and community, which can be appealing for work-life balance.
